Subsidised school milk and child health: exploration of policy implementation and pilot feasibility of outcome measures

Project: Research

Description

A feasibility study led by University of Durham, following N8 Pump priming funding (26.2.19). Focus is initially identifying the barriers/reasons for schools within the North-East not using the school milk subsidiary. The second arm of this feasibility project is trialing outcome measures of interest (bone health, obesity, diet, physcial strength) to inform a future funding application to conduct an RCT.
